Abstract
The absolute/convective nature of the instability sustained by the Bat chelor vortex is determined in the plane of swirl and co-flow paramete rs for different azimuthal wavenumbers. Swirl is shown to induce a tra nsition to absolute instability for jets and wakes without requiring a ny counter-flow. The transitional helical mode is n = -1 for wakes and n = -2 or n = -3 for co-flowing jets.
